Is there any reason that a vertical motor can not be mounted
horizontally ? I happen to have one and would like to use it
horizontally to save money by not buying a new horizontal motor.
Answer Posted / akshri
A motor will run whether placed vertically or horizontally.All
we have to see that the bearings of motor should take up the
thrust,radial as well as axial.
